Abstract
Electrodialysis with ion exchange membranes is one of the most important membrane methods, which deals with the problems of desalination of salted waters, waste water minimization, production of ultra-pure water, concentration of dilute solutions, separation of electrolytes and non-electrolytes and with the production of acids and alkalis from their salts. Mathematical modelling and laser interferometry have been applied for calculation and visualisation of local characteristics under electrodialysis demineralization.
